More Information: What is a life group? Simply, it is a small group of people that meet regularly with the common purpose of learning about the Bible and the Christian life, caring for one another, having fun in a relaxed and informal setting, and creating the opportunity for developing friendships. Life groups are the primary places of really connecting with others as well as giving and receiving care in our church. Life groups are a simple expression of the biblical church.
Our life groups meet ten to twelve weeks three times a year: Spring, Summer, and Fall.
